Hardware plate leveling device
Technical Field
The utility model relates to the technical field of hardware processing equipment, in particular to a hardware plate leveling device.
Background
The hardware products are widely applied in the fields of modern society, such as hardware tools, hardware parts, daily hardware, building hardware, security articles and the like, and the fields of production, processing and installation do not depart from the hardware. One reason why hardware is widely used is that the hardware has higher strength and can meet a plurality of scenes needing certain strength requirements. The finished hardware products are various in types and shapes, and in the production and processing engineering, a plurality of intermediate materials are used, such as plate-shaped hardware materials, and various metal products, industrial parts and the like can be obtained through further processing of the plate-shaped five-metal materials. With the development of science and technology, the requirements on the quality of the plate-shaped hardware material are higher and higher, and the plate-shaped hardware material is required to have excellent plate shape, high thickness and size precision, smooth surface, good performance and the like, so that the subsequently produced parts can achieve higher quality and precision. According to the prior leveling mode, the appearance defect of a product, namely poor flatness of a plate surface, often occurs, and the existence of the product brings certain difficulties for use and deep processing.

Detailed Description
Example (b):
the embodiments of the present invention will be described in detail with reference to the accompanying drawings, and it is to be understood that the described embodiments are merely a part of the embodiments of the utility model, and not all of the embodiments.
In the description of the present invention, it is to be understood that the terms "upper", "lower", "front", "rear", "left", "right", "top", "bottom", "inner", "outer", and the like, indicate orientations or positional relationships based on the orientations or positional relationships shown in the drawings, are merely for convenience in describing the present invention and simplifying the description, and do not indicate or imply that the device or element being referred to must have a particular orientation, be constructed and operated in a particular orientation, and thus, should not be construed as limiting the present invention.
Referring to the attached drawings, the hardware plate flattening device comprises a conveying mechanism 1, a flattening head 2 and a bearing table 3, wherein the conveying mechanism 1 comprises a feeding end and a discharging end; the bearing table 3 runs between the feeding end and the discharging end and comprises a plurality of positioning edges; the leveling head 2 is arranged above the bearing table 3, comprises a plurality of leveling rollers 4 and is used for leveling a hardware plate 9 conveyed by the bearing table 3 in a follow-up manner; the feeding end of the conveying mechanism 1 is provided with a guide mechanism which can accurately guide the hardware plate 9 into the positioning edge of the bearing table 3. Add man-hour, at first treat smooth five metals board 9 propelling movement by conveying mechanism 1 and enter into plummer 3 on, fix through the location limit on it, treat smooth five metals board 9 and move to the discharge end by the feed end along with plummer 3, the flattening running roller 4 of 3 tops of plummer in the operation process rotates the extrusion, carry out the flattening to five gold plates 9 that pass through from its below and handle, five metals board 9 after the flattening are seen off from the discharge end, the automatic level and smooth processing of five gold plates 9 is realized to the high efficiency.
It can be understood that, as the auxiliary hardware plate 9 is fixed so that it can be better extruded and leveled, the height of the positioning edge protruding from the surface of the bearing platform 3 should not be greater than the thickness of the hardware plate 9 to be leveled, and the positioning edge can be fixed in height and can also be designed into a structure with adjustable height so as to be suitable for processing hardware plates 9 with different thicknesses. As a preferable implementation manner, in this embodiment, the positioning edge is a U-shaped frame, and includes an L-shaped fixing edge 5, a straight movable edge 6, and a tightening nut, and the straight movable edge 6 is slidably disposed on the bottom edge of the L-shaped fixing edge 5, and is fastened by the tightening nut to adjust the width of the U-shaped frame, so as to adapt to the processing of the hardware plates 9 with different sizes.
As shown in the accompanying drawings, the guide mechanism in this embodiment is a guide rod 7 separately disposed on both sides of the feeding end, and extends to the opening of the U-shaped frame, and may be a straight rod or an arc rod, the relative width between the two guide rods 7 gradually decreases from outside to inside, and the width of the inner end of the guide rod corresponds to the width of the opening of the U-shaped frame. Corresponding to the above embodiments, in this embodiment, the guide rod 7 on the side opposite to the straight movable edge 6 is a movable guide rod 7, so as to adaptively adjust the relative width of the two guide rods 7, and adapt to the U-shaped frame. As preferred embodiment, in this embodiment, the inner of guide arm 7 still is equipped with rotates deflector roll 8, rotate the deflector roll 8 cover and establish the flexible glue cover, can guarantee on the one hand that guiding mechanism can be accurate will treat level and smooth hardware board 9 and leading-in to in the U type frame, can cushion the collision simultaneously, avoid the damage of hardware board 9 corner.
